Description

VMware View Planner 4.x prior to 4.6 Security Patch 1 contains a remote code execution vulnerability. Improper input validation and lack of authorization leading to arbitrary file upload in logupload web application. An unauthorized attacker with network access to View Planner Harness could upload and execute a specially crafted file leading to remote code execution within the logupload container.

Is CVE-2021-21978 actively exploited?

Active exploitation of CVE-2021-21978 has not been confirmed. The EPSS score is 90.9%, indicating the estimated prob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.

What is the CVSS score for CVE-2021-21978?

CVE-2021-21978 has a CVSS v3 base score of 9.8 (CRITICAL severity).
